Product Description:

In this thriller directed by Roar Uthaug, a geologist races to save a Norwegian tourist town from a catastrophic tsunami caused by a mountain collapse. After finding himself in the midst of a natural disaster, Kristian (Kristoffer Joner) searches for his family while trying to protect the area's residents.
